The Emergence of Social Features in Online Casinos
Social gaming introduces community-driven features into traditional online casino play. Players can now connect with friends, share achievements, and compete in leaderboards without wagering real money. Many platforms integrate social media elements, allowing users to send gifts, exchange tokens, or participate in group tournaments. This social interaction enhances engagement, transforming solitary gaming into a shared, community-oriented experience.
Bridging the Gap Between Fun and Competition
Unlike conventional casino games focused solely on monetary rewards, social gaming emphasizes fun, progress, and friendly competition. Players often earn points, badges, or virtual prizes instead of cash, keeping the atmosphere light and enjoyable. This approach appeals to casual gamers who enjoy the thrill of slots and casino games without financial risk. The competitive elements—such as ranking systems and seasonal events—add motivation and replay value, encouraging regular participation.
Integration of Social Media and Multiplayer Platforms
Online casinos and developers increasingly integrate social gaming features into their ecosystems. Through connected accounts and interactive lobbies, players can join friends in real time or watch others play via live streams. Social media integration allows sharing of big wins, tournament results, and milestones, creating a sense of accomplishment within gaming communities. This also serves as organic promotion for platforms, helping them attract new users through social visibility.
Impact on Player Retention and Experience
Social gaming significantly boosts user retention by creating emotional connections between players and the platform. The sense of belonging and interaction encourages longer engagement periods compared to solo play. It also supports responsible gaming, as social environments tend to reduce isolation and promote balanced play. Developers are now focusing on hybrid models that combine real-money gaming with social engagement tools, offering the best of both worlds.
